We are seeking an Interactor to join our Show Experience team at the Warner Bros. Studio Tour London – The Making of Harry Potter. As an ambassador for the Tour, you will guide, entertain, and enlighten visitors whilst on their magical journey.
Your responsibilities will include:
- Proactively engaging and assisting with the varied needs of our Visitors by delivering a world-class Visitor experience.
- Presenting a friendly, helpful, and knowledgeable interface between the Tour itself and all visitors to the Tour.
- Actively listening and leading with empathy, integrity, and transparency.
- Proactively seeking ways to support your team to work towards the collective goal of exceeding Visitors\’ expectations.
- Continuously improving your own skills and knowledge in relation to the Franchise, Tour operations, and your own personal performance.
- Conducting Added Value Tours and assisting in Audio Descriptive Tours as required.
- Working with the management team to enhance the Show and Visitor experience at every opportunity.
- Holding pride for your workspace – keeping a safe and tidy working area.
- Adhering to and championing all guidelines and policies in accordance with WBD policies and procedures.
To be successful in this role, you will need:
- Understanding of the Harry Potter film series and filmmaking.
- Previous work experience in a customer/visitor-facing role, where a strong emphasis was placed on quality of service and/or experience.
- Presentation skills – enthusiasm and ability to speak in public to groups of up to 300 on a microphone.
- Demonstrable ability to learn new skills and adapt to new situations within a visitor-focused environment.
- Able to contribute positively and enjoy working effectively as part of a large and varied team.
We offer a competitive hourly rate of £12.60, 25 days holiday (pro-rata), and a range of benefits, including GymPass, exclusive access to our Screeners App, staff discounts, and free on-site staff car parking.
Contracts range from 16 to 40 hours per week, and you will be required to work weekends as part of this working pattern. Weekend work includes both Saturday and Sunday.
